The Indian team is practicing in Perth away from public view as the ground is covered with black sheets to block the view of spectators.
As Virat Kohli began preparations for the upcoming Border Gavaskar Trophy, some fans were seen climbing nearby trees to watch him play. It shows the craze and popularity of Kohli as fans are always eager to catch a glimpse even if it requires going all out.

However, not even these leaves could stop them from finding ways; Fans risked their well-being and climbed trees, giving them a rough idea of what was happening in the practice session.
Those fans also seemed confident in India’s chances in the impending Border Gavaskar Trophy, with one of them predicting a whitewash over Australia. They were also sure that Virat Kohli, who has not been in good form of late, will regain his lost touch and score big in the five-match Test series.

Virat Kohli’s tremendous record on Australian soil
While Virat Kohli’s recent form and a similar pattern of dismissals are a cause for concern, he boasts of a formidable record in Australia in red-ball cricket. He has 1352 runs at an average of 54.08 in 25 Test innings, comprising four fifty-six centuries.
He handles pace and rebound well and is always up to the challenge posed by a fierce Australian attack. That said, Kohli’s recent form will surely be in the back of his mind, and he would like to start after a quiet season at home, where he consistently struggled with the spinners.
The Indian batting line-up will be slightly inexperienced and vulnerable, especially in the absence of Rohit Sharma. Therefore, Kohli must set an example as a senior player.
India also does not have Cheteshwar Pujara or Ajinkya Rahane this time. India’s chances will largely depend on Kohli’s performance in the competition.
